About The Position

A loving family in Roswell is seeking an experienced, nurturing, and engaging nanny to care for their happy and healthy 11-week-old baby. The ideal candidate will have strong newborn and infant experience and be passionate about supporting developmental milestones during the first year of life. The family is looking for someone who can help establish healthy sleep habits, assist with nap routines, and support the baby's transition from contact naps to more independent sleep. Daily responsibilities will include age-appropriate developmental play, tummy time, sensory activities, singing, reading, narrating daily routines, outdoor walks, and finding enriching classes and activities within the community. The family hopes to find a nanny who is warm, bubbly, communicative, and genuinely interested in becoming a trusted extension of the family. Spanish-speaking candidates are highly encouraged to apply, as bilingual exposure would be considered a wonderful bonus. During nap times, the nanny will assist with child-related household tasks, including washing bottles and pump parts, maintaining and organizing the nursery, rotating toys, stocking diapering supplies, baby laundry, organization projects, taking out diaper pails, and communicating household supply needs. Additional responsibilities may include light housekeeping, unloading the dishwasher, meal preparation, and cooking simple, healthy family meals. As the baby grows, the nanny may also assist with introducing purees and age-appropriate feeding routines. The family values professionalism, excellent communication, flexibility, and a proactive attitude, and they are seeking someone who can confidently support both the baby's development and the smooth operation of the household while the parents work. There is 1 small dog in the home.
